Overview:

  • The Drucker Diagnostics Eclipse Axis PRP Centrifuge System is a cutting-edge device designed to streamline the preparation of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) for various medical applications. Featuring advanced centrifugal technology, the Eclipse Axis ensures optimal separation of blood components, maximizing platelet yield while maintaining cell integrity. Its user-friendly interface and customizable protocols allow for efficient operation in both clinical and research settings, catering to diverse patient needs. Compact and quiet, the system enhances workflow efficiency without compromising on performance, making it an essential tool for healthcare professionals seeking to harness the regenerative power of PRP therapy.
